Magicline combines global expansion with diversity awareness campaign

We’re not only striving to provide the most innovative solutions around gym management but also to raise awareness about the importance of supporting gender diversity and equity
– Maike Kumstel, International Business Development Manager

German software giant Magicline is shaking up the global fitness market and actively working on diversity in the sector.

Magicline has been growing rapidly in the past five years and expanded across Europe. Part of the Sport Alliance Group, the brand has been driving the digitalisation of the fitness industry for over 30 years with innovative, state-of-the-art software solutions that increase member satisfaction and retention.

Social responsibility and driving inclusivity

Diversity and inclusion are values that the Sport Alliance wants to focus on and drive not only internally, but also globally in the sector.

Now, Magicline wants to make use of its strong market position and set an example in terms of social responsibility and actively championing these values.

As there is no reliable data and information on the status of gender equity and inclusion, Sport Alliance is conducting a survey on diversity and inclusion.

To do so, Sport Alliance has partnered with the Women in Fitness Association as a first step.

"Gender equality and an open approach to the issue is now more relevant than ever in modern society,” says Artur Jagiello, head of marketing and communications at Sport Alliance.

“With our survey, we want to shed more light and raise awareness of this issue."

The first survey results will be presented at FIBO/ the European Health and Fitness Forum on 6 April. A white paper delving into the findings will also be published in the following months.

Company Details
Magicline
Magicline was founded in 1988 and is part of the Sport Alliance group since 2013. Sport Alliance GmbH’s brand portfolio specializes in innovative solutions around gym management, financial services and a centralized supply chain management solution for gyms, franchises and chains. Because of Magicline’s extensive experience and the continuous development of the software more than 4,500 studios including some of the biggest fitness chains and franchise systems such as McFIT (RSG Group), clever fit and Bodystreet put their trust in the solution already. Magicline started to expand globally in August 2020 and received a 60 million Euro funding in 2021 from private equity firm PSG to accelerate international growth.
